在之前的办公自动化系列文章中,我已经对Python操作Excel的几个常用库openpyxl、xlrd/xlwt、xlwings、xlsxwriter等进行了详细的讲解。 为了进一步带大家了解各个库的异同,从而在不同场景下可以灵活使用,本文将横向比较7个可以操作 Excel 文件的常用模块,在比较各模块常用操作的同时进行巩固学习! 首先让我们来整体把握下不...
综上所述,关于Python中Excel文件操作的最有名的库,pandas和openpyxl无疑是其中的佼佼者。pandas以其强大的数据分析和处理能力而著称,而openpyxl则以其对.xlsx文件的全面支持和灵活的操作方式而受到广泛欢迎。其他库如xlrd、xlwt、xlwings等也在特定场景下有广泛的应用。
在 Excel 中的 Python 单元格中使用 Python 导入语句(例如import numpy as np)将 Python 库导入 Excel。 此语句导入 NumPy库,并为其分配别名np。 在 Python 单元格中输入此导入语句后,可以在该工作簿中的整个 Python 公式中以np的形式引用 NumPy 库。 提示:为了确保在运行 Python 公式之前导入库,请在工作...
Excel 中的 Python 将 Python 分析的强大功能引入 Excel。 使用它通过 Python 代码在 Excel 中处理数据。 直接在单元格中键入 Python,Python 计算在 Microsoft 云中运行,结果将返回到工作表。 Excel 中的 Python 附带Anaconda提供的一组核心 Python 库,可用于简化数据分析、查找模式和隐藏见解,以及使用绘图可视化数据。
Excel 中的 Python 使用seaborn库创建可视化效果。 将使用以下导入语句为 Excel 中的 Python 自动导入 seaborn库,以便使用别名SNS引用它。 import seaborn as sns 要使用 seaborn 库创建鸢尾花数据集的配对绘图,请执行以下步骤: 在Excel 单元格的 Python 中输入以下代码片段。 此代码片段会将配对绘图存储为名为pair...
·xlutils基于 xlrd/xlwt,老牌 python 包,算是该领域的先驱,功能特点中规中矩,比较大的缺点是仅支持 xls 文件。 各个库的基本用法 一,openpyxl基本代码 import openpyxl # 新建文件 workbook = openpyxl.Workbook() # 写入文件 sheet = workbook.activesheet['A1']='A1' ...
// 打开cmd,默认在C盘,先进入D盘 d: cd python pip install xlwt-1.3.0-py2.py3-none-any.whl 使用pip安装 我这里因为已经安装过xlwt,所以第一次install提示我已经安装了。 我先uninstall了xlwt,这也是卸载库的方法,pip uninstall lib_name就能将对应的库卸载 再次pip install xxx.whl后安装成功会有Successf...
1. 安装openpyxl库,在命令行中使用pip install openpyxl命令进行安装。 2. 导入openpyxl库,使用import openpyxl语句将openpyxl库导入到Python脚本中。 3. 打开Excel文件,使用openpyxl.load_workbook()方法打开指定的Excel文件,得到一个工作簿对象。 4. 获取工作簿中的所有sheet,使用workbook.sheetnames属性获取工作簿中所...
python中操控excel的几个库:xlwt,xlrd,xlutils 一、xlrd和xlwt模块介绍 xlrd模块提供在任何平台上从excel电子表格(.xls和.xlsx)中提取数据的功能,xlwt模块提供生成与Microsoft Excel 95 到2003版本兼容的excel文件的功能。 1、安装方法 #方法一:pip3 install xlrd...
python Excel库对比 我们发现可以操作excel的库有很多种,我们常用的就三种方法 第三方库 xlwt/xlrd:用于生成和读取比较老的excel文件,比如xls格式,最大行数限制为65536行。其中xlrd是读excel,xlwt是写excel的库。 第三方库 openpyxl:用于生成2010之后新的excel文件,...